Microsoft Forms Frontier Company to Bet on Enterprise AI
emmanuelvivier · x · 2026-07-04
Microsoft has invested about $2.5 billion to establish the subsidiary Frontier Company, staffing it with around 6,000 engineers to focus on the deployment of enterprise AI. This is positioned as an industrial-level AI investment for operations, going beyond simple Copilot assistance.
